Should Grapefruit Be Refrigerated? Optimal Storage Tips For Freshness

should you store grapefruit in the refrigerator

Storing grapefruit properly is essential to maintain its freshness, flavor, and nutritional value. While grapefruit can be kept at room temperature for a few days, many wonder if refrigerating it is a better option. The refrigerator’s cool, humid environment can extend the fruit’s shelf life by slowing down the ripening process and preventing spoilage. However, refrigeration may also affect its texture and taste over time. Understanding the pros and cons of refrigerating grapefruit can help you make an informed decision to ensure you enjoy this citrus fruit at its best.

Optimal Storage Temperature: Grapefruit lasts longer in cool, dry conditions, ideally around 50-55°F

Grapefruit, like many citrus fruits, is sensitive to temperature extremes. Storing it at the optimal temperature not only extends its shelf life but also preserves its flavor and texture. The ideal range of 50-55°F strikes a balance between slowing down the ripening process and preventing chilling injury, which can occur below 40°F. This temperature zone is cooler than room temperature but warmer than a typical refrigerator, making it a Goldilocks scenario for grapefruit storage.

To achieve this, consider using a cool pantry, basement, or a dedicated fruit storage drawer if your refrigerator has one. If you lack access to a space within this range, aim for the coolest area in your home, away from direct sunlight and heat sources. For those living in temperate climates, an unheated porch or garage during cooler months can serve as a natural storage solution. However, monitor these spaces to ensure temperatures remain stable, as fluctuations can accelerate spoilage.

A practical tip for maintaining the ideal temperature is to use a thermometer to monitor storage conditions. If you’re storing grapefruit in bulk, such as after a trip to a farmer’s market or orchard, consider investing in a small, temperature-controlled appliance designed for produce storage. For smaller quantities, wrapping grapefruit in paper or placing it in a perforated plastic bag can help regulate moisture levels, complementing the cool temperature to create an optimal environment.

Refrigerator Benefits: Refrigeration extends freshness but can reduce flavor and texture over time

Storing grapefruit in the refrigerator can significantly extend its shelf life, often adding an extra 2-3 weeks of freshness compared to room temperature storage. This is because refrigeration slows the ripening process by reducing the activity of enzymes that break down the fruit’s cells. For households that don’t consume grapefruit daily, this benefit is particularly valuable, as it minimizes waste and ensures the fruit remains edible for longer periods. However, this preservation comes with a trade-off that affects the sensory experience of the fruit.

The cold environment of a refrigerator can gradually diminish the flavor and alter the texture of grapefruit. At temperatures below 50°F (10°C), the fruit’s natural sugars become less accessible, resulting in a less vibrant, slightly muted taste. Additionally, the cold can cause the fruit’s cell walls to break down more rapidly once it’s removed from the refrigerator, leading to a softer, less juicy texture. For those who prioritize peak flavor and texture, this may outweigh the benefits of extended freshness.

To mitigate these effects, consider a hybrid storage approach. Store grapefruit in the refrigerator if you plan to use it within 2-3 weeks, but allow it to come to room temperature for at least 30 minutes before consuming. This restores some of the fruit’s natural sweetness and improves its texture. Alternatively, if you’re using grapefruit primarily for juicing or cooking, refrigeration is ideal, as the slight flavor and texture changes are less noticeable in processed forms.

For optimal results, store grapefruit in the crisper drawer of the refrigerator, where humidity levels are higher, helping to maintain moisture. Avoid washing the fruit before refrigerating, as excess moisture can promote mold growth. If you prefer not to refrigerate, keep grapefruit in a cool, dry place away from direct sunlight, and consume it within 7-10 days for the best quality. Counter Storage: Room temperature is fine for short-term storage, up to 1-2 weeks

Storing grapefruit at room temperature is a practical option if you plan to consume it within a week or two. This method preserves the fruit’s natural texture and flavor, as refrigeration can sometimes dull its taste and make the peel drier. For short-term storage, a cool, dry countertop away from direct sunlight is ideal. This approach is particularly useful if you’ve purchased a small batch of grapefruit or intend to use it quickly in meals or snacks.

The key to successful counter storage lies in monitoring the fruit’s condition. Grapefruit stored at room temperature will gradually soften and may develop a slightly sweeter taste as it ripens. However, this process also makes it more susceptible to spoilage if left too long. To maximize freshness, ensure the fruit is not stacked or crowded, as this can trap moisture and accelerate decay. A well-ventilated bowl or basket works best.

Comparatively, counter storage offers convenience but requires vigilance. Unlike refrigerated grapefruit, which can last up to 2-3 weeks, room-temperature storage is a shorter-term solution. It’s ideal for households that use citrus frequently or for those who prefer the fruit’s natural, unchilled state. If you notice the grapefruit becoming overly soft or the peel wrinkling, it’s a sign to use it immediately or switch to refrigeration to extend its life.

For practical tips, consider pairing counter-stored grapefruit with daily routines. Slice one for breakfast, juice it for a midday refreshment, or add segments to salads for a tangy twist. If you’re unsure about the fruit’s freshness, a simple test is to gently press the peel—firmness indicates it’s still good, while excessive give suggests it’s past its prime. Humidity Considerations: Avoid excessive moisture; store in a perforated bag if refrigerated

Grapefruit, with its vibrant flesh and tangy flavor, is a citrus gem that deserves proper storage to maintain its freshness. When considering refrigeration, humidity becomes a critical factor. Excessive moisture can accelerate spoilage, causing the fruit to become soft, moldy, or develop a mealy texture. To combat this, storing grapefruit in a perforated plastic bag is a simple yet effective strategy. The perforations allow for adequate air circulation while retaining just enough humidity to keep the fruit hydrated without drowning it in moisture.

From an analytical perspective, the science behind humidity control is straightforward. Grapefruit, like other citrus fruits, has a natural protective wax layer that helps retain moisture. However, when placed in a high-humidity environment, such as an airtight container or the crisper drawer without ventilation, condensation can form, promoting mold growth. Conversely, too little humidity can cause the fruit to dehydrate, leading to shriveling and loss of juiciness. A perforated bag strikes the perfect balance, mimicking the fruit’s natural storage conditions by allowing excess moisture to escape while maintaining optimal hydration.

For those seeking practical instructions, here’s a step-by-step guide: Place the grapefruit in a loosely closed perforated plastic bag, ensuring the holes are not blocked. If using a solid plastic bag, poke 4–6 small holes (each about the size of a pencil tip) to allow airflow. Store the bagged fruit in the refrigerator’s crisper drawer, which typically maintains a humidity level of around 90%. Avoid overcrowding the bag, as this can trap moisture and increase the risk of spoilage. For whole grapefruits, this method can extend freshness by up to 2–3 weeks, compared to just 1 week at room temperature.

Comparatively, storing grapefruit without humidity control can lead to stark differences in quality. For instance, a grapefruit left uncovered in the refrigerator may dry out within a week, while one stored in an airtight container could develop mold in the same timeframe. The perforated bag method outperforms both, preserving the fruit’s texture, flavor, and nutritional value.
